How they compare
UNICEF: East Asia and Pacific currently reports 2.90 million against 84,457 in Greece, a difference of 2.82 million.
That makes UNICEF: East Asia and Pacific's figure about 34.4 times Greece's.
Across all 17 years both countries report, UNICEF: East Asia and Pacific has been ahead every year.
Greece ranks 25th and UNICEF: East Asia and Pacific ranks 23rd of 134 countries.
UNICEF: East Asia and Pacific has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Greece | UNICEF: East Asia and Pacific |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 68,712 | 1.95 million | 1.88 million | UNICEF: East Asia and Pacific |
| 2000s | 37,973 | 2.02 million | 1.98 million | UNICEF: East Asia and Pacific |
| 2010s | 73,774 | 3.44 million | 3.36 million | UNICEF: East Asia and Pacific |
| 2020s | 75,080 | 2.87 million | 2.79 million | UNICEF: East Asia and Pacific |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
